Man To Embark On 'Narrow Way Around' Honoring Late Father, Benefitting the YMCA
On July 6, Dave McCarter will embark on a 6,000-mile motorcycle trip, filming for a documentary series and encouraging folks to support a new Y facility
Motorcycle enthusiast David McCarter will embark on a long-distance motorcycle ride called “The Narrow Way Around” from the parking lot of the Wenatchee YMCA on July 6, and the community is invited to gather and help see him off shortly after 9 am.
McCarter is riding to honor his late father, Dave Sr., and to support one of their favorite organizations, the YMCA. I met up with him in the parking lot of the Y recently and asked him about what inspired him, and why he chose to raise awareness and funds for the Y.
“As a fourth grader I was here a lot at the after-school programs,” McCarter said. “I came from a single-parent family. Dad was working all the time and this was my home after school until he came and picked me up after work.”

The plan is to ride solo to the Harley Davidson Museum in Milwaukee, Wisconsin in time for the Harley Davidson 120th anniversary homecoming.
“My mission is to go see the Harley museum. That was my dad’s dying wish,” he said.
McCarter’s route will take him past Mount Rushmore, across Glacier National Park, to the motorcycle Mecca of Sturgis, South Dakota, and into parts of Canada on a trip he and his father always wanted to take together.
The two were inspired by the 2004 adventure series called the “Long Way Round” featuring Ewan McGregor and Charlie Boorman in which the pair rides around the world and documents their experiences. Like Boorman and McGregor, McCarter plans to film his trip and make a documentary series about his experiences on the road.
